The brand’s name, Moncler, is a shortened version of Monestier-de-Clermont. The company initially catered to mountaineers and adventurers, providing them with durable and warm gear to withstand harsh alpine conditions. By the 1980s, Moncler had become a favorite among skiers and outdoor enthusiasts, known for its impeccable craftsmanship and innovative designs.
In the early 2000s, Moncler underwent a significant transformation under the leadership of Remo Ruffini, who acquired the brand in 2003. Ruffini repositioned Moncler as a luxury fashion brand, blending its technical expertise with high-end aesthetics. This move catapulted Moncler into the global spotlight, making it a staple in both the fashion and outdoor industries.
